Understanding the Ecological Influence

The environmental impact of roof covering shelfs mainly stems from their effect on a lorry's the rules of aerodynamics and weight, both of which influence fuel consumption and emissions.

The rules of aerodynamics and Drag:

Roofing system racks, specifically when loaded with gear, increase a lorry's frontal location and disrupt its wind resistant account. This raised drag pressures the engine to work more challenging to preserve rate, bring about higher gas consumption.
The result of drag is especially visible at freeway speeds, where the resistance from air boosts considerably. Also a little increase in drag can bring about a significant rise in gas intake over fars away.
Boosted Weight:

Adding a roofing system shelf, particularly when filled with hefty products, increases the general weight of the lorry. This included weight needs more power to move the lorry, additional contributing to greater gas usage.
The influence of weight is most considerable during acceleration and uphill driving, where even more power is required to move the vehicle.
Carbon Emissions:

Greater fuel usage straight correlates with increased carbon emissions. For each gallon of gasoline melted, roughly 20 extra pounds of carbon dioxide are released right into the environment. Therefore, the more fuel a lorry uses, the higher its carbon impact.
These factors highlight the need to consider the ecological impact of making use of roof racks, particularly for those that are conscious of their carbon impact.

Evaluating the Impact:

To comprehend the real-world effect of roof covering racks, a number of research studies have actually been carried out to evaluate the results on gas performance and exhausts.

Fuel Effectiveness Losses:

Research studies have actually revealed that a vacant roof covering shelf can lower fuel efficiency by roughly 1-2% because of enhanced drag. However, when packed with gear, this reduction can enhance to 10-25%, depending upon the shapes and size of the freight.
For instance, a big cargo box can decrease fuel effectiveness by as much as 15% at highway speeds, while a set of kayaks placed on the roof covering can create a comparable reduction due to their aerodynamic account.
Increased Carbon Emissions:

Based on the gas efficiency losses, the added carbon dioxide discharges can be considerable over the course Find out of a year. For a vehicle that travels 15,000 miles each year, a 10% decrease in gas effectiveness could cause an added 500 extra pounds of CO2 emissions.
These searchings for highlight the importance of being mindful of how roof shelfs are utilized and taking steps to mitigate their ecological effect.

Techniques to Mitigate Ecological Effect

While roof shelfs do have an environmental impact, there are numerous techniques you can employ to decrease this impact, allowing you to proceed using them responsibly.

Select Aerodynamic Roofing System Racks:

When picking a roof shelf, choose layouts that are extra wind resistant, such as low-profile cargo boxes or structured crossbars. These options create much less drag, helping to preserve much better fuel efficiency.
Some producers provide roof shelfs that are specifically designed to minimize wind resistance, integrating functions such as tapered edges and wind deflectors.
Get Rid Of Roofing Racks When Not Being Used:

One of the most basic methods to decrease the ecological influence of roofing racks is to eliminate them when they are not in use. An empty roof covering rack still develops drag, so removing it can boost fuel performance.
If you often use a roof shelf, take into consideration going with a model that is very easy to install and get rid of, allowing you to take it off when it's not needed.
Load Smart and Light:

Be mindful of what you pack on your roofing system shelf. Avoid overwhelming it with hefty things that might enhance the vehicle's weight and fuel intake. Rather, pack only what you require and disperse the weight equally to maintain vehicle equilibrium.
Ideally, pack items inside the lorry to minimize the load on the roof covering rack. This aids to keep the automobile's weight down and improves the rules of aerodynamics.
Drive at Moderate Rates:

Since the effect of drag rises at higher rates, driving at modest speeds can aid reduce the result of a roofing system shelf on gas performance. Decreasing your speed by simply 5-10 miles per hour on the freeway can bring about significant gas savings.
Additionally, preserving a consistent rate and preventing fast velocity can additionally boost gas performance, lowering the total ecological influence.
Normal Upkeep:

Maintaining your lorry in excellent problem can additionally help in reducing the ecological influence of roof covering shelfs. Normal upkeep, such as keeping tires correctly inflated and guaranteeing the engine is running efficiently, can boost fuel economic climate.
Furthermore, checking that the roof shelf is firmly installed and that all components remain in excellent problem can lower drag and stop unneeded fuel consumption.
